Finn: | Really? I'm full of beans! |
Feifei: | Beans? That's the one thing we didn't eat! |
Finn: | Oh yes, we didn't. Yes, well what I meant wasI'm full of energy. Full of beans is an expression meaning full of energy and enthusiasm. Isn't that right Feifei? Feifei? Hello? |
